Individual Therapy

Individual therapy offers personalized attention to address the specific needs of individuals facing addiction. Therapists utilize evidence-based practices such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) to help patients identify triggers and develop coping strategies. This one-on-one approach facilitates deeper exploration of personal challenges and fosters a supportive environment for healing. Group Therapy

Group therapy serves as a support network for individuals in recovery, allowing them to share experiences and gain insights from peers. Facilitated by licensed therapists, these sessions create a sense of community that reinforces accountability and motivation. Patients can benefit from diverse perspectives, which enhance their understanding of addiction. Family Counseling

Family counseling engages family members in the recovery process, addressing the impact of addiction on relationships. This therapy helps to rebuild trust and enhance communication within the family unit. Trained counselors guide families in understanding addiction dynamics and establishing healthy boundaries.
